Decoding the Phrase: Kung Hei Fat Choi

The phrase "Kung Hei Fat Choi" (恭喜發財) is Cantonese, one of the major dialects spoken in China. Each character holds a specific meaning, contributing to the overall sentiment of the greeting:

  • 恭喜 (Gōng xǐ): This means "congratulations" or "to offer congratulations." It expresses joy and well wishes.

  • 發 (Fā): This character means "to get rich," "to prosper," or "to flourish." It signifies abundance and good fortune.

  • 財 (Cái): This character means "wealth," "riches," or "fortune." It represents material prosperity and success.

Therefore, a direct translation of "Kung Hei Fat Choi" would be "Congratulations and make a fortune!" or "Wishing you prosperity and wealth!" It's a heartfelt expression of hope for good luck and financial success in the coming year.

Beyond the Literal Meaning: Cultural Significance

While the literal translation is straightforward, the deeper meaning of "Kung Hei Fat Choi" goes beyond mere monetary gain. It represents a holistic wish for overall prosperity and good fortune encompassing:

  • Financial Well-being: Of course, financial prosperity is a significant aspect. The wish reflects a hope for abundance and security.
  • Health and Happiness: A prosperous year also includes good health and happiness for oneself and one's loved ones.
  • Good Relationships: Strong familial and social bonds are essential to a fulfilling life. The greeting implicitly acknowledges the importance of these relationships.
  • Success and Achievement: The wish extends to success in all aspects of life, including career, personal growth, and endeavors.

How to Use "Kung Hei Fat Choi" Appropriately

"Kung Hei Fat Choi" is a versatile greeting used in various contexts during Lunar New Year:

  • Informal Settings: It's perfectly acceptable to use this phrase with family, friends, and colleagues in informal settings.
  • Formal Settings: While appropriate in most formal settings, consider adding a respectful prefix like "新年快樂" (Xīnnián kuàilè – Happy New Year) for a more formal tone.
  • Gift-Giving: It's a natural accompaniment when giving gifts during Lunar New Year, adding a warm and auspicious touch.
  • Receiving Greetings: Respond with "Kung Hei Fat Choi" or a simple "Thank you." Reciprocating the greeting is a sign of politeness and good manners.
